【问题标题】:What are the differences between Json.Net versions?Json.Net 版本之间有什么区别?
【发布时间】:2011-08-08 18:19:00
【问题描述】:

我正在通过 monodroid 开发一个 android 应用程序。我必须移植一个 windows phone 7 应用程序,它使用Json.net Windows 7 Phone 版本。

我想知道它与常规的 .net 4.0 版本有什么区别?是否有 monodroid 版本或者我可以使用常规的 .net 4.0 版本?

如果我可以为两个设备使用同一个库,那将是最好的,因为我可以将它放在一个共享库中并停止一些重复的代码。

【问题讨论】:

  • AFAIK 的主要区别在于构建目标。我假设您在定位 monodroid 时需要从源代码重建。

标签: .net json windows-phone-7 json.net xamarin.android


【解决方案1】:

这是他们关于 Windows Phone 7 版本的博客文章。它解释了为什么它是一个不同的版本,但听起来你可以有一个版本,它只支持在两个平台上工作的一组功能。

http://james.newtonking.com/archive/2011/01/03/json-net-4-0-release-1-net-4-and-windows-phone-support.aspx

【讨论】:

  • 尽管该项目引用了它,但我正在查看的部分似乎正在使用一些内置的东西。 DataContractJsonSerializer(来自 System.Runtime.Serialization)。但是,我的 android 解决方案似乎只有 2.0.5,而我需要 4.0。
猜你喜欢
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 2010-12-11
  • 2014-08-20
  • 2011-04-12
  • 1970-01-01
相关资源
最近更新 更多